1979 Mitsubishi Lancer A72 Type-LB 1400SL review from Philippines

"The first Lancer was also the best"

What things have gone wrong with the car?

Nothing, except for minor wear and tear that you expect from a car that's 27 years old.

General comments?

Lightweight, compact and reliable thanks to its engineering simplicity.

Known as the "King of Cars" in Africa because it dominated the Safari Rally in the 70's which during it's time was the biggest rally in the FIA World Rally Championship, stretching over five days and a gruelling 6,000 km.

Old Lancers never die... this car is already a Legend.
